**Q: How do I unlock the Stagewright seat-map renderer's admin console if the session store resets?**

The renderer for the Pellamy Theatre caches seat geometry locally, so a reset only affects credentials. Open the recovery dialog from the gear menu and wait for the prompt. Enter the passphrase exactly as written below, including spacing.

recovery phrase for fajeg-hagug: holox-fenmir

## Runbook: BranchSweep Bot

BranchSweep deletes merged branches older than 90 days from Hollowpine repos. Before enabling it on a new repository, confirm protected-branch patterns are registered, since the bot honors them strictly but cannot guess. Dry-run mode is recommended for your first week. The settings the bot currently runs with appear below.

config for kafof-bawef:
holath:
  log_level: debug
  metrics_host: metrics.holath.qorvelsys.internal
  pin: 2191
  pool_size: 32

Subject: On-call handover — ProfileVault sharding

Hi Dario,

Handing off the ProfileVault resharding work. Shards 0–11 are migrated; 12–15 are mid-copy and should finish overnight. Dual-write mode stays on until verification passes, so expect elevated write latency alarms — they're acknowledged. If the copier stalls, restart it via the migration console; don't touch the cutover flag. Questions about the verification job should go to the storage platform queue at the address below.

— Priya

escalation mailbox, hadug-bajog: sormir@norvalabs.internal